Well, you see, people learned waterbending from the moon and the tides of the sea. Earthbenders learned from badger-moles, which appear in the series, in Book Two: Earth. Firebenders learned from dragons, like Iroh, Aang, and Zuko. Airbenders learned from the air bison (also known as wind buffalo) like Appa. Assuming Appa is not the last air bison, the next Avatar will have to study airbending from Appa or another air bison (even though Appa is the last air bison, who knows?)
